European online gambling group Global Gaming 555 has named Nigel Balcarres as its new Head of Compliance for its growing Malta operations.

Prior to this, Balcarres, who has more than three decades of experience in the gaming and betting industry, held a position with the same title at NetEnt for three-plus years. There he reportedly played a key role in securing Global Gaming’s first UK license. He was also responsible within the jurisdiction,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) and Curacao and its Asian operations, for managing compliance.

As Global Gaming’s new head of Compliance, Balcarres will be charged with overseeing licensing application of the Group, as well as readying the future expansion plans for Ninja Casino, its leading B2C brand and the company’s B2B operations, according to the press release.

Commenting on the appointment, Mark Wadsworth, Director of Global Gaming’s companies in Malta, said Balcarres brings to the company the experience it needs to obtain and have success in operating licenses in new markets, along with the key skills required for it to continue offering fully compliant innovative services. Wadsworth added, “His understanding of gaming and regulatory frameworks around the world is of significant advantage for us, and we look forward to his contribution to the business.”
